Hot Water Heater Replacement in Boca Raton, FL
Hot water heater replacement services involve removing an existing unit and installing a new one to ensure consistent hot water supply throughout a property. These projects typically cover standard tank models, tankless systems, or specialty units tailored to the needs of homeowners in Boca Raton, FL. Property owners usually want to understand the types of water heaters available, the signs indicating a replacement is needed, and how the process might impact their daily routines. Knowing the differences between traditional and tankless systems, as well as the benefits of upgrading, can help inform a decision about when and what type of unit to install.
Homeowners often request hot water heater replacement when their current system is no longer functioning efficiently, shows signs of leaks, or is reaching the end of its lifespan. Before requesting a repl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the size of the unit, energy efficiency, and compatibility with existing plumbing. Understanding these aspects can facilitate a smoother transition to a new system that meets household demands and preferences. Proper selection and timely replacement can help maintain reliable hot water access and improve energy usage.

Hot Water Heater Replacement Questions
When is it time to replace a hot water heater? Signs include frequent breakdowns, water discoloration, or insufficient hot water supply.
What types of hot water heaters are available for replacement? Common options include tank-style, tankless, and energy-efficient models suited for different needs.
How can property owners prepare for a hot water heater replacement? Clearing the area around the unit and ensuring easy access can facilitate the installation process.
What should be considered when choosing a new hot water heater? Factors include energy efficiency, size, and compatibility with existing plumbing and electrical systems.
